1. AirMirror
Download from PlayStore

AirMirror is by the same developers of AirDroid. In fact, it's a part of AirDroid. The feature lets you remote control devices within its network. It functions a lot like TeamViewer and similar apps. You remote into a device and you can do various things. That includes installing or uninstalling apps, accessing the camera, and even play some games. It's completely free to use once you have AirDroid.

2. DLive
Download from PlayStore

DLive is a new video streaming app. The service isn't new and it has over 500,000 active users currently. It uses blockchain to stream videos rather than traditional methods. Creators also earn money in the form of cryptocurrency instead of ad revenue. The service seems skewed toward gaming over other types of content. However, there are other types of content there as well. It's something a little bit different from the norm and videos seem to stream pretty well. The app is currently free with no in-app purchases.

3. Driving Detective
Download from PlayStore

Driving Detective is a driving safety app. It detects when you are in a moving vehicle. The app then puts your device in Do Not Disturb mode and silences notifications. That way you can focus on driving instead of whoever is texting you.

4. Navigation Gestures
Download from PlayStore

Navigation Gestures is an app from XDA Developers. It gives you universal gesture control over your phone. The app creates a space at the bottom of the phone. You use it to swipe in various directions to do various things. It also supports single and double tapping, tap and hold, and, of course, swiping in basically any direction. The free version includes your basic functions. Meanwhile, the pro version adds gestures for your notification shade, quick settings, power menu, media controls, and more. It's a neat little app for gesture control fanatics.

5. YouTube Music
Download from PlayStore

YouTube Music launched to the public this week. The new music streaming service centers around the YouTube experience rather than just streaming audio. The app UI is a little basic and the idea is a little derivative. It should improve over the next several months and years. It's good, but not great.
